Impact of test temperature on functional degradation in Fe-Ni-Co-Al-Ta shape memory alloy single crystals C. Sobrero, C. Lauhoff, D. Langenkämper [et al.]

P. 129430 (1-3)Abstract: The present paper focuses on the analysis of functional fatigue properties in <001>-oriented single crystalline Fe-Ni-Co-Al-Ta shape memory alloys. Superelastic cycling experiments up to 4.5% at different temperatures were conducted and revealed excellent cyclic stability at lower testing temperatures. Transmission electron microscopy observations shed light on the influence of precipitation and dislocation activity on functional stability.
